The Origins of the Surname Kaisan

The surname Kaisan is an intriguing and unique surname that has its roots in several different countries around the world. With a total incidence of 92 in Japan, 86 in Indonesia, 12 in India, and smaller numbers in Germany, Cambodia, Tanzania, Papua New Guinea, the United States, Brazil, Bangladesh, Malaysia, England, Kenya, Kazakhstan, Maldives, Nigeria, and Russia, the surname Kaisan is truly a global phenomenon.

Japanese Origins

In Japan, the surname Kaisan is believed to have originated from the Japanese words "kai", meaning "sea" or "ocean", and "san", meaning "mountain" or "hill". This suggests that individuals with the surname Kaisan may have had ancestors who lived near the sea or mountains, or who were involved in activities related to the sea or mountains, such as fishing or mountaineering.

The surname Kaisan is relatively common in Japan, with an incidence of 92. This indicates that there are likely multiple branches of the Kaisan family spread throughout the country, each with its own unique history and lineage.
